Understanding Online ADHD Tests for Adults: A Comprehensive Guide
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ental disorder that impacts millions of adults worldwide. While it is typically related to children, lots of adults live with ADHD without recognizing it. The symptoms can impact various aspects of life, consisting of work, relationships, and overall wellness. With the development of digital health tools, online ADHD tests have actually ended up being increasingly popular among adults looking for to comprehend their symptoms better. This post will check out the purpose of these tests, what they generally involve, how to translate the results, and regularly asked questions about the process.
What is an Online ADHD Test for Adults?
An online ADHD test for adults is a screening tool designed to help people determine potential symptoms of ADHD Test For Adults Online. These tests typically consist of a series of questions evaluating attention span, impulsivity, hyperactivity, company skills, and other related behaviors. While these tests do not serve as an official diagnosis, they can be an important starting point for people who think they might have ADHD.

Online ADHD tests usually follow a standardized format and are created to determine an individual's symptoms. Here's what to expect when taking one:
Questionnaire Format: Most tests include multiple-choice or true/false questions. They'll ask about experiences, behavior patterns, and sensations related to ADHD symptoms.
Self-Assessment: Participants answer questions based upon their personal experiences over the previous 6 months. This self-assessment offers insight into how symptoms manifest in every day life.
Scoring: After finishing the questionnaire, a scoring system will examine actions. Depending upon the platform, you may get immediate feedback or a summary of your outcome.
Recommendation to Professional Help: While the majority of online tests are not diagnostic tools, they can highlight the need for more assessment from a healthcare specialist.

Arise from an online ADHD test must always be seen as initial. Here's how to approach interpretation:
Score Analysis: Look at your rating, which might show the probability of ADHD symptoms. Higher ratings usually recommend a stronger existence of traits related to ADHD.
Review Symptoms: Consider how your symptoms associate with the assessment results. It's vital to reflect on whether symptoms significantly impact daily functioning and lifestyle.
Subsequent Steps: If outcomes recommend possible ADHD Assessment Test, the next sensible step is to speak with a healthcare professional, such as a psychologist or psychiatrist, for a comprehensive assessment.

While online ADHD tests can offer insight into potential symptoms, they are not conclusive diagnostic tools. They are best utilized as initial assessments, triggering users to look for more assessment from a certified professional.
2. How long does it take to complete the test?
Most online ADHD tests take about 10 to 20 minutes to finish, depending upon the variety of concerns and the information asked for.
3. Is it necessary to spend for an online ADHD test?
Numerous reliable online ADHD tests are offered Free Add Test of charge, however some might charge a cost for additional resources or personalized feedback. Always research study the test's credibility before proceeding.
4. What should I do if my test results show a likelihood of ADHD?
If your outcomes recommend the prospective presence of ADHD, it is a good idea to consult with a licensed psychological health specialist who focuses on ADHD. They can carry out a thorough assessment and go over prospective treatment alternatives.
5. Can I self-diagnose ADHD based upon an online test?
Self-diagnosis is prevented. While online tests can supply beneficial info, identifying ADHD Test Adults needs in-depth assessment from a skilled specialist.
Online ADHD tests for adults are a useful tool for self-reflection and awareness. They can help individuals identify possible symptoms and assist them towards looking for an official medical diagnosis. Nevertheless, it's vital to approach these tests as preliminary evaluations rather than conclusive diagnostics. Accurate medical diagnosis and treatment for ADHD require the competence of an expert. If you believe you have ADHD after taking an online Add Test Online, it's essential to take the next action and speak with a doctor trained to assess and handle the disorder. With the right support, adults with ADHD can lead fulfilling, productive lives.
